    NEED FOR R&M

    As regards 500MW simulator is concerned,the computer and hard panel with instructorstation were supplied by M/s Siemens AG .Theyare no more in the simulator business.I/O

    interface system were supplied by M/s TataPower. They are not in a position to give timelysupply of I/O cards and reliability is notfoolproof. Procurement and proper functioningof these cards have been taking even 2 years.The

    prices of I/O cards are very high, on the groundthat most of the components used are nowobsolete & have to be procured at a higher cost.

    We are facing same problem in 200MW

    simulator.

    NEED FOR R&MNTPC

    New NTPC projects & other power utilities areoperated from LVS/OWS system and olderstations either from a totally hardwired UCB or

    a mix of both. Thus operators tuned with bothtypes of experience are required over at leastten years from now.Hence, R&M of thesimulator by porting of existing software intonew hardware platform and augmenting it by

    adding LVS/OWS based platform is the mostfeasible solution to the problem.

    In view of foregoing, it is suggested thatR&M both the simulator may please be taken up

    at the earliest

    R&MACTIVITIES

    The proposed R&M activities includes :

    Replacement of existing ENCORE/GOULDsimulation and DAS computers by latest

    servers.Replacement of I/O interface system with

    latest DCS/PLC based system.

    Replacement of obsolete panel hardware as on

    required basis. Incorporating the LVS/OWS based operator

    HMI.

    Establishing network connectivity to PMI, so

    that training may be provided at PMI.

    R&M PROCEDURES

    As has been done in our DAS R&M cases,thewhole R&M activity is proposed to be done inseveral phases/steps in order to minimize thedown time.

    Most of the software work can be done onthe new hardware platform and connectivityto the panel can be done with minimum down

    time of say 15 days or less.During that time training will be continued

    with existing configuration.

    BENEFITS WITH R&M

    INTENGIBLE BENEFITS :The simulator training gives a feeling of

    operating a real power plant with no fuel cost,

    no wastage of time,no losses and repairs. It rises the level of proficiency and

    confidence.

    Training in emergency handling helps in

    saving down time of plant.Training in efficient operation helps the

    operator in improvement of overall efficiencyand life expectancy of plant equipment.
